On evening
Grammar usage guide and real-world examplesUSAGE SUMMARY
The phrase "On evening" is not correct in standard written English.
It is typically used incorrectly as it should be "In the evening" when referring to the time of day. Example: "We usually have dinner in the evening when everyone is home."

FAQs
What is the correct way to refer to the evening as a time of day?
The correct way is to say "in the evening". For example, "I enjoy reading "in the evening"".
Is it ever correct to say "on evening"?
No, "on evening" is generally considered grammatically incorrect. You should use ""in the evening"" instead.
What are some alternatives to saying something happens "in the evening"?
You can use phrases like "during the evening", "at night", or "as night falls", depending on the specific context.
Why is "on evening" considered incorrect?
The preposition "on" is typically used with specific dates or days, while "in" is used for parts of the day like morning, afternoon, and evening. So, it's grammatically correct to say ""in the evening"".
